import net.pterodactylus.sone.freenet.wot.event.IdentityRemovedEvent;
import net.pterodactylus.util.config.Configuration;
-import com.google.common.base.Optional;
import com.google.common.collect.ImmutableList;
import com.google.common.collect.ImmutableSet;
import com.google.common.eventbus.EventBus;
/**
* Unit test for {@link Core} and its subclasses.
- *
- * @author <a href="mailto:bombe@pterodactylus.net">David ‘Bombe’ Roden</a>
*/
public class CoreTest {
Identity identity = mock(Identity.class);
when(identity.getId()).thenReturn("sone-id");
Sone sone = mock(Sone.class);
- when(database.getSone("sone-id")).thenReturn(Optional.of(sone));
+ when(database.getSone("sone-id")).thenReturn(sone);
PostReply postReply1 = mock(PostReply.class);
PostReply postReply2 = mock(PostReply.class);
when(sone.getReplies()).thenReturn(ImmutableSet.of(postReply1, postReply2));
mismatchDescription.appendText("is not PostRemovedEvent");
return false;
}
- if (((PostRemovedEvent) item).post() != post) {
- mismatchDescription.appendText("post is ").appendValue(((PostRemovedEvent) item).post());
+ if (((PostRemovedEvent) item).getPost() != post) {
+ mismatchDescription.appendText("post is ").appendValue(((PostRemovedEvent) item).getPost());
return false;
}
return true;
mismatchDescription.appendText("is not SoneRemovedEvent");
return false;
}
- if (((SoneRemovedEvent) item).sone() != sone) {
- mismatchDescription.appendText("sone is ").appendValue(((SoneRemovedEvent) item).sone());
+ if (((SoneRemovedEvent) item).getSone() != sone) {
+ mismatchDescription.appendText("sone is ").appendValue(((SoneRemovedEvent) item).getSone());
return false;
}
return true;